Transaction ae6417bb3db56a413548b5af0064e5c82240173f4e107146cb903bbb30cce585

1 Input
1 Outputs
  • ae6417bb3db56a413548b5af0064e5c82240173f4e107146cb903bbb30cce585:0
  • value  115330
    address  1LfhuJULxYYpomaKyHt5DGxZShr3eBkXPM